The coronavirus is impacting how we honor loved ones at funerals.

Due to the pandemic, only a few family and friends gathered to say farewell to a well known and loved man from Green Township on Saturday.

Samuel Durr Senior, a retired steelworker, was proud to be a long time volunteer at the Greenford Christian Church.

His sons honored their dad's wishes, and a horse-drawn wagon took his body to the cemetery.

His sons hope to have a celebration of life ceremony at a future date.

The 77-year-old passed away after complications from a stroke.
